Prometheus 的数据可视化界面有哪些?

在当今这个大数据时代,数据可视化已成为数据分析的重要手段。Prometheus 作为一款强大的开源监控和告警工具,其数据可视化界面更是备受关注。本文将为您详细介绍 Prometheus 的数据可视化界面,帮助您更好地理解和运用 Prometheus。

一、Prometheus 的数据可视化界面概述

Prometheus 的数据可视化界面主要指的是 Grafana,它是 Prometheus 官方推荐的数据可视化工具。Grafana 支持多种数据源,包括 Prometheus、InfluxDB、MySQL 等,其中 Prometheus 是最常用的数据源之一。通过 Grafana,用户可以轻松地创建各种图表、仪表盘和报告,实现数据的可视化展示。

二、Grafana 的主要功能

  1. 丰富的图表类型:Grafana 支持多种图表类型,如折线图、柱状图、饼图、雷达图等,满足不同用户的需求。

  2. 自定义仪表盘:用户可以根据自己的需求,将各种图表、指标、告警等信息组合成一个完整的仪表盘。

  3. 告警功能:Grafana 提供强大的告警功能,用户可以设置阈值、发送通知等,实时监控数据的异常情况。

  4. 数据源管理:Grafana 支持多种数据源,用户可以方便地添加、编辑和管理数据源。

  5. 模板管理:Grafana 提供丰富的模板库,用户可以下载并应用到自己的仪表盘中。

三、Prometheus 数据可视化界面操作步骤

  1. 安装 Grafana:首先,您需要在您的服务器上安装 Grafana。以下是 Linux 系统下的安装命令:
sudo apt-get update
sudo apt-get install grafana

  1. 启动 Grafana 服务
sudo systemctl start grafana-server

  1. 访问 Grafana:在浏览器中输入 http://localhost:3000,即可进入 Grafana 的登录界面。

  2. 添加 Prometheus 数据源

    • 点击左侧菜单栏的“Data Sources”。
    • 点击“Add data source”。
    • 选择“Prometheus”作为数据源类型。
    • 输入 Prometheus 服务器的地址、端口等信息。
    • 点击“Save & Test”测试数据源连接。
  3. 创建仪表盘

    • 点击左侧菜单栏的“Dashboards”。
    • 点击“New dashboard”。
    • 在仪表盘编辑页面,选择“Add panel”添加图表。
    • 选择合适的图表类型,并配置图表的参数。
    • 保存仪表盘。

四、案例分析

以下是一个使用 Prometheus 和 Grafana 进行数据可视化的案例:

某企业需要监控其服务器 CPU 使用率,以确保服务器性能稳定。通过 Prometheus 搜集服务器 CPU 使用率数据,并使用 Grafana 创建一个仪表盘,实时展示 CPU 使用率图表。当 CPU 使用率超过阈值时,Grafana 会自动发送告警通知,提醒管理员关注。

五、总结

Prometheus 的数据可视化界面——Grafana,以其丰富的功能、易用的操作和强大的性能,成为 Prometheus 用户的首选。通过本文的介绍,相信您已经对 Prometheus 的数据可视化界面有了更深入的了解。在实际应用中,您可以根据自己的需求,灵活运用 Prometheus 和 Grafana,实现数据可视化,为企业决策提供有力支持。

猜你喜欢:故障根因分析